Skip to main content

Search

Items tagged with: GNOMECalendar


In case you missed it, the #GUADEC 2024 talk about #GNOMECalendar has now been published as a standalone video on the #GNOME channel! youtube.com/watch?v=MFs0KGpJlK…


GNOME Calendar users, rejoice!

After 7 months of pain and suffering, we finally reworked the event details popover, which will be available in GNOME 47!

The new event details popover builds on top of the existing UI/code, while adding a few improvements and behavioral changes:

  • The popover displays the changes-prevent (lock) icon when the event is read-only.
  • Each section is properly separated with separators, with equal amount of margins.
  • Location and Meetings section are mutually exclusive; only one is shown.
  • When an event has no event note, the popover will always explicitly display that there's no event description.
  • The action button adapts its icon and tooltip text depending on the event permission.

gitlab.gnome.org/GNOME/gnome-c…

#GNOME #GNOMECalendar #GTK #libadwaita #GTK4


Good news: the #GNOMECalendar .ics individual event file importing dialog's handling of UTC times has been fixed in the development version! If you are running the nightly flatpak, you can already use it to add to your calendar the remaining #GUADEC2024 day 3 events you want to attend :blobcatcoffee: gitlab.gnome.org/GNOME/gnome-c…


I would love to encourage y'all #GUADEC attendees to use the "Download" button from the event's Indico platform (that button is in each event's details page) to use it directly in #GNOMECalendar, but… it turns out that you'd run into this silly timezones bug where the event importer dialog considers UTC times to be the local time 🤦

So… can I motivate someone to send a merge request for gitlab.gnome.org/GNOME/gnome-c… ? This would be timely for #GNOME's main conference next week 😉

#Linux #OpenSource


— Them: “Please test #GNOMECalendar's sidebar again”
— Me, coming back from another round of testing: “Code’s haunted”
— Them: “What?”
— Me, loading a pistol and getting back to the bug tracker: “Code’s haunted”

gitlab.gnome.org/GNOME/gnome-c…

#MaintainerLife #FreeSoftware #OpenSource #QA #testing #programming #GNOME


Every #GNOMECalendar user owes a HUGE amount of gratitude to @khemicalkoder for solving the timelines backend bug that flew under the radar for years! It was causing at least two heisenbugs and obfuscating testing for a bunch of other bugs in the #GNOME calendaring application. This merge request was absolutely amazing: gitlab.gnome.org/GNOME/gnome-c…

In addition to the 2 bugs fixed, these two other issues become clear enough for newcomers to fix:
* gitlab.gnome.org/GNOME/gnome-c…
* gitlab.gnome.org/GNOME/gnome-c…


Part 1 of my #GNOMECalendar #webcal subscriptions #UX bugfixing trilogy has been merged today! No more duplicate calendars created by accident when adding a web calendar URL 🥳 gitlab.gnome.org/GNOME/gnome-c…

#GNOME #opensource